加密骗局与安全 加密货币的机构采用

重现 macOS 空间式 Finder:从历史、实现到实用指南

加密骗局与安全 加密货币的机构采用
解析如何在现代 macOS 上重新实现空间式 Finder 功能,介绍实现原理、安装步骤、配置技巧、安全与兼容性考量,帮助用户恢复文件夹窗口的记忆性与工作流程一致性

解析如何在现代 macOS 上重新实现空间式 Finder 功能,介绍实现原理、安装步骤、配置技巧、安全与兼容性考量,帮助用户恢复文件夹窗口的记忆性与工作流程一致性

macOS 的 Finder 在早期以"空间式窗口管理"著称,用户可以让每个文件夹以固定的位置和大小打开,形成稳定的桌面布局体验。随着系统演进,Finder 的行为逐渐偏离这种空间隐喻,变成更偏向单一窗口或标签的模型。对于习惯于每个文件夹拥有固定窗口位置与大小的用户来说,重新获得这种体验具有明显的工作效率与心理舒适度价值。近期在 GitHub 上出现的项目 SpatialFinder 试图在现代 macOS 环境中重现空间式 Finder,通过脚本化的方式记录并恢复每个文件夹的窗口状态,值得关注与实践。 理解空间式 Finder 的价值有助于判断是否需要安装类似方案。空间式窗口管理强调位置的记忆性,用户将桌面或显示器划分为若干功能性区域,每个文件夹固定在某一区域,从而减少寻找窗口的时间,形成视觉与操作的连贯性。

对于多任务工作者、设计师或需要同时查看多个项目文件夹的人来说,恢复窗口空间记忆能节省频繁调整窗口的操作成本。SpatialFinder 的目标就是把这类记忆从 Finder 的内置行为中剥离出来,通过外部脚本在文件夹级别实现持久化。 SpatialFinder 的实现基于一组 Shell 脚本,核心工作流程可以用一句话概括:在文件夹内保存窗口的几何信息并在打开时恢复。该项目包含保存状态的脚本、加载状态的脚本以及用于查找目标文件夹的辅助脚本,启动和集成通常通过一个安装脚本将必要的规则注册到窗口管理工具中。保存的状态被写入到每个文件夹下的隐藏文件 .framedata.json,内容包含窗口位置、尺寸、屏幕标识等信息。打开文件夹时,加载脚本读取该文件并将窗口调整到保存的几何布局。

实现细节决定了使用成本与安全考量。SpatialFinder 推荐结合 yabai 使用,yabai 是 macOS 下强大的窗口管理工具,可以通过脚本精确控制窗口位置与尺寸。然而,yabai 在某些功能上需要禁用 SIP(系统完整性保护),这涉及系统安全策略的调整,对安全敏感的用户或企业设备可能不适用。项目同时提供一种较轻量的替代方式:通过隐藏 Finder 侧边栏和工具栏来让每个文件夹以独立窗口打开,从而在一定程度上模拟空间式行为,但这种方法无法在不借助系统级窗口管理工具的前提下实现精确的窗口位置恢复。 安装与配置并非难事,但需要注意几个关键点。首先,要把脚本放置到系统 PATH 中的某个目录并确保可执行,这样安装脚本可以顺利为 yabai 注入规则或为系统注册监听事件。

其次,安装脚本会创建或更新 yabai 规则,用于在 Finder 打开新窗口时触发加载脚本。如果不使用 yabai,就需要依靠 Finder 的 AppleScript 或其他触发机制来调用加载脚本。第三,对于想只恢复尺寸或只恢复位置的用户,加载脚本包含了注释化的配置入口,允许选择性地启用或禁用位置恢复或尺寸恢复,从而适配不同的工作习惯。 在使用过程中会遇到一些常见问题与限制。空间式恢复依赖于文件夹路径和名称的唯一性,当两个不同位置但名称相同的文件夹存在时,原始项目里设计为不保存也不恢复以避免冲突。此外,当文件夹位于 iCloud Drive 或者系统路径发生别名重定向时,脚本可能需要特殊处理以正确识别目标位置。

项目最近一次提交中就加入了对 iCloud 命名特殊情况的处理逻辑,显示出社区对边缘场景的持续改进。 安全和隐私同样是考虑重点。保存窗口几何的隐藏文件位于用户 Documents 文件夹下,理论上这些 JSON 文件不应包含敏感信息,但在多人共享设备或备份同步到云端时,仍需评估数据泄露风险。如果使用 yabai 并选择禁用 SIP,需要理解其后果:禁用 SIP 会扩大潜在的安全攻击面,因此应在受控环境或充分理解风险的前提下进行操作。对于无法或不愿变更 SIP 设置的用户,使用 Finder 内置的界面调整配合脚本触发是一条更保守的折中方案。 从兼容性角度出发,macOS 不同版本之间的窗口管理行为和 Finder 的实现细节可能存在差异。

SpatialFinder 以 Shell 脚本为基础,依赖系统命令、yabai 的事件接口以及 Finder 的窗口标识方法。升级 macOS 后若发现脚本失效,优先检查 yabai 与脚本调用的命令是否仍然可用,以及 Finder 的窗口识别是否发生变化。社区维护的脚本通常会在仓库中记录已知兼容性问题与修复建议,关注 GitHub 仓库的提交历史与 Issues 可以获取及时的修正信息。 部署时的实用建议有助于减轻初期摩擦。推荐先在非关键用户账号或虚拟机中进行测试,观察脚本在典型工作流程下的行为。启用前对 Documents 文件夹进行备份,以便在出现文件或隐私问题时快速恢复。

安装后花一段时间适应窗口自动恢复的节奏,可能需要微调加载脚本的触发时机与保存频率,以避免在重命名、移动文件夹或临时调整窗口布局时产生不期望的状态保存。 除了功能实现,背后的设计哲学也值得讨论。空间式 Finder 强调桌面语义的一致性,人机交互中空间记忆能显著降低认知负荷。虽然标签页和单一窗口模式在现代操作系统中普遍推崇,但对某些使用情境而言,空间式布局的物理可视化和稳定性仍然不可替代。SpatialFinder 这样的项目通过简单的持久化策略,把用户熟悉的空间隐喻重新带回现代系统,强调界面可以通过可编程方式被还原而不是被系统固定修改。 开发者与高级用户还可以基于现有脚本扩展功能。

可以将框架文件集中到自定义的数据库中,以便在多台设备之间同步窗口布局或者为同一项目建立多套布局方案。结合 launchd 或其他守护进程,可以实现更精细的状态保存频率和事件触发策略。对有编程能力的用户而言,也可以把 Shell 脚本逻辑迁移为更健壮的 Python 或 Swift 工具,以便实现更好的错误处理、日志记录和跨平台兼容层。 社区支持是开源项目成长的关键。SpatialFinder 的仓库展示了简洁的实现与实际可用的脚本,用户可以通过提交 Issue 报告兼容性问题或需求,也可以提交 Pull Request 为 iCloud 等特殊场景提供更完善的处理。参与社区讨论有助于形成更多测试场景和最佳实践,推动脚本在更多 macOS 版本上稳定运行。

对企业用户来说,可以考虑将类似功能集成到内部运维脚本中,由 IT 部门统一测试与部署。 总结来看,重现 macOS 的空间式 Finder 并不需要深奥的系统改动,基于文件夹级别的几何状态持久化和外部窗口管理工具的配合即可实现。SpatialFinder 提供了一条可行、快速上手的路径,让习惯空间式窗口管理的用户在现代 macOS 环境中恢复熟悉的工作台。选择是否启用这样的工具取决于个人工作习惯、安全需求与系统允许的配置权限。对于追求高效、稳定桌面布局的用户,投入少量时间进行安装与配置能够在长期使用中带来持续的效率提升和更舒适的工作体验。 。

飞 加密货币交易所的自动交易 以最优惠的价格买卖您的加密货币

下一步
在社交媒体政治广告快速增长的背景下,揭示Facebook(Meta)平台上深度伪造、仿冒和订阅陷阱等诈骗行为的机制、案例、监管难题与可行对策,为公众、监管者与平台提供实务性建议和防范指南
2026年02月24号 22点41分28秒 社交平台政治广告的暗潮:Facebook上深度伪造与欺诈广告泛滥的真相与应对

在社交媒体政治广告快速增长的背景下,揭示Facebook(Meta)平台上深度伪造、仿冒和订阅陷阱等诈骗行为的机制、案例、监管难题与可行对策,为公众、监管者与平台提供实务性建议和防范指南

围绕 Moonala 浏览器的核心设计、隐私承诺、多引擎架构与使用场景展开说明,帮助用户评估其安全性、性能与适用性,为想要下载或试用的读者提供实用建议与对比视角
2026年02月24号 22点49分23秒 Moonala:一款强调隐私与多引擎支持的全新浏览器深度剖析

围绕 Moonala 浏览器的核心设计、隐私承诺、多引擎架构与使用场景展开说明,帮助用户评估其安全性、性能与适用性,为想要下载或试用的读者提供实用建议与对比视角

全面解析 EmbeddingGemma 的架构来源、嵌入生成流程、训练损失及开发配方,为搜索、向量检索与 RAG 场景提供实践建议与性能优化方向
2026年02月24号 22点53分46秒 EmbeddingGemma 深度解析:架构、训练策略与实战应用

全面解析 EmbeddingGemma 的架构来源、嵌入生成流程、训练损失及开发配方,为搜索、向量检索与 RAG 场景提供实践建议与性能优化方向

回顾从1995年Print Club问世至今,普利库拉如何从街机照相机演变为承载青春记忆、美颜滤镜与社交体验的文化符号,以及它在技术、市场与次文化中的持续创新与前景展望
2026年02月24号 23点01分28秒 不止贴纸:普利库拉(Purikura)三十年演进与文化魅力

回顾从1995年Print Club问世至今,普利库拉如何从街机照相机演变为承载青春记忆、美颜滤镜与社交体验的文化符号,以及它在技术、市场与次文化中的持续创新与前景展望

介绍 Immich v2.0.0 稳定版的关键改进、升级建议、备份策略与未来路线,帮助个人与团队安全高效地部署与维护自托管照片云
2026年02月24号 23点05分55秒 Immich 2.0.0 稳定发布:自托管相册的重要里程碑与实操指南

介绍 Immich v2.0.0 稳定版的关键改进、升级建议、备份策略与未来路线,帮助个人与团队安全高效地部署与维护自托管照片云

揭示1970年代冈贝国家公园黑猩猩群体之间爆发的致命冲突、研究者发现及其对灵长类行为学与人类起源讨论带来的深远影响,兼谈生态、社会与保护的当代启示。
2026年02月24号 23点10分50秒 震惊世界的黑猩猩战争:冈贝丛林里的暴力与反思

揭示1970年代冈贝国家公园黑猩猩群体之间爆发的致命冲突、研究者发现及其对灵长类行为学与人类起源讨论带来的深远影响,兼谈生态、社会与保护的当代启示。

围绕比特币价格在年底冲击20万美元的市场逻辑、链上指标、机构资金动向与潜在风险进行深入解读,提供可操作性视角与风险管理要点,帮助读者理清当前牛市赛道的驱动因素与不确定性
2026年02月24号 23点16分17秒 比特币再度起航?解析冲击20万美元的可能性与风险

围绕比特币价格在年底冲击20万美元的市场逻辑、链上指标、机构资金动向与潜在风险进行深入解读,提供可操作性视角与风险管理要点,帮助读者理清当前牛市赛道的驱动因素与不确定性